Management of Mild Thrombocytopenia (Platelet Count 118,000/μL) in Primary Care

For a platelet count of 118,000/μL in primary care, observation without treatment is appropriate unless the patient has active bleeding, requires invasive procedures, needs anticoagulation, or has a high-risk profession/lifestyle. 1

Immediate Assessment

No immediate intervention is required at this platelet level. Treatment is rarely indicated for platelet counts above 50,000/μL in the absence of specific risk factors 1. At 118,000/μL, your patient has mild thrombocytopenia that poses minimal bleeding risk 2.

Key Clinical Factors to Evaluate

  • Active bleeding symptoms: Check for petechiae, purpura, ecchymosis, mucosal bleeding, or any spontaneous bleeding 2
  • Medication review: Identify drugs that may cause thrombocytopenia (heparin products within past 5-10 days, antibiotics, NSAIDs, antiplatelet agents, chemotherapy) 1
  • Comorbidities: Assess for liver disease, renal impairment, autoimmune conditions, recent viral infections, or malignancy 1
  • Anticoagulation needs: Determine if patient requires or is currently on anticoagulants or antiplatelet therapy 1
  • Planned procedures: Identify any upcoming surgeries or invasive procedures 1
  • Occupational/lifestyle risks: Consider professions or activities predisposing to trauma 1

Diagnostic Workup

First Step: Confirm True Thrombocytopenia

  • Repeat complete blood count using heparin or sodium citrate tube to exclude pseudothrombocytopenia (platelet clumping artifact) 2
  • Review peripheral blood smear to confirm platelet count and assess for platelet clumping, large platelets (megathrombocytes), or other cell line abnormalities 2, 3

Essential Laboratory Tests

If thrombocytopenia is confirmed and isolated (normal hemoglobin, white blood cell count):

  • HIV and Hepatitis C serology: Common secondary causes of immune thrombocytopenia 4
  • Thyroid function tests (TSH): Hypothyroidism can cause decreased platelet production 1
  • Antiphospholipid antibody panel: Lupus anticoagulant, anticardiolipin antibodies, anti-β2-glycoprotein I 4
  • Liver function tests: Assess for hepatic disease causing sequestration or decreased production 3
  • Coagulation studies: PT/INR, aPTT, fibrinogen if bleeding present 4

When to Consider Additional Testing

  • Bone marrow aspiration: Only if diagnosis remains unclear after initial workup, thrombocytopenia persists >6-12 months, or other cell lines are abnormal 4
  • H. pylori testing: May be considered in immune thrombocytopenia workup 1

Management Algorithm

For Platelet Count 118,000/μL Without Bleeding

Observation is the appropriate management strategy 1, 5. The American Society of Hematology strongly recommends against treating patients with platelet counts ≥30,000/μL who are asymptomatic or have only minor mucocutaneous bleeding 1, 5.

  • No corticosteroids or immunosuppressive therapy should be initiated based solely on this platelet count 1, 5
  • No activity restrictions are necessary at this level 2
  • Full therapeutic anticoagulation can be safely administered if clinically indicated, as this is well above the 50,000/μL safety threshold 4, 5

Monitoring Strategy

  • Repeat platelet count in 1-2 weeks to establish trend (acute vs. chronic thrombocytopenia) 2
  • Weekly monitoring if platelet count is declining 4
  • Monthly monitoring once stable if chronic thrombocytopenia is established 4

When to Refer to Hematology

Refer to hematology if: 1

  • Platelet count drops below 50,000/μL 4
  • Platelet count continues to decline despite management 4
  • Cause of thrombocytopenia remains unclear after initial workup 4
  • Patient develops bleeding symptoms 1
  • Patient requires invasive procedures with bleeding risk 1

Ensure follow-up with hematologist within 24-72 hours if platelet count drops below 20,000/μL 1

Specific Clinical Scenarios

If Patient Requires Anticoagulation

  • Platelet count >50,000/μL: Full therapeutic anticoagulation without modification 4, 5
  • Platelet count 25,000-50,000/μL: Reduce LMWH to 50% therapeutic dose or use prophylactic dosing 4
  • Avoid DOACs if platelets drop below 50,000/μL due to increased bleeding risk 4

If Patient Requires Invasive Procedures

Procedure-specific platelet thresholds 4:

  • Central venous catheter: 20,000/μL
  • Lumbar puncture: 40,000/μL
  • Major surgery/liver biopsy: 50,000/μL
  • Epidural catheter: 80,000/μL
  • Neurosurgery: 100,000/μL

At 118,000/μL, all procedures can be safely performed without platelet transfusion 4, 5.

If Immune Thrombocytopenia (ITP) is Diagnosed

Treatment is NOT indicated at platelet count of 118,000/μL 1. Treatment thresholds for ITP:

  • Platelet count >30,000/μL without bleeding: Observation only 1, 5
  • Platelet count <30,000/μL with bleeding symptoms: Consider corticosteroids 1
  • Platelet count <20,000/μL regardless of symptoms: Consider treatment 1

Critical Pitfalls to Avoid

  • Do not treat based solely on platelet number without considering bleeding symptoms and clinical context 4
  • Do not assume ITP without excluding secondary causes (medications, infections, liver disease) 4
  • Do not initiate corticosteroids in elderly patients with platelet counts >30,000/μL without bleeding due to significant harm from steroid exposure 4
  • Do not normalize platelet count as treatment goal; target is ≥50,000/μL to reduce bleeding risk if treatment becomes necessary 4
  • Avoid NSAIDs and medications affecting platelet function (aspirin, clopidogrel) unless specifically indicated 5

Patient Education

  • Reassure patient that mild thrombocytopenia at this level rarely causes bleeding complications 2
  • Instruct to report new bruising, petechiae, nosebleeds, gum bleeding, or any unusual bleeding 2
  • Avoid trauma when possible, but no specific activity restrictions needed 2
  • Review medications and avoid NSAIDs unless specifically prescribed 5
